The meaning of Baldrics
Baldrics – definition
nounA belt for a sword or other piece of equipment, worn over one shoulder and reaching down to the opposite hip.
Usage examples:
The whole thing then had to be hung via a baldric either over the shoulder or around the waist.

Word origin
Middle English baudry, from Old French baudre, of unknown ultimate origin.
